Automation Engineer II
$86.4k - $129.6kSchneider Electric
Join our technical delivery team as an Automation Engineer II. As an Automation Engineer you will be responsible for the implementation of quality building automation control practices while providing engineering/technical oversight for construction site projects for a retrofit/energy performance contracting team. You will work closely with clients, project managers, and other engineering teams to support the implementation of customized solutions that optimize building performance, energy efficiency, and occupant comfort.
What will you do?
- Work as an individual or part of a team for delivery on schedule and project requirements.
- Implement hardware and software designs in compliance with engineering principles, company standards and contract requirements during installation of project
- Oversight of electrical installation subcontractor for compliance to design, schedule, and implementation methods
- When not viable to utilize subcontractor; Self-Perform low voltage electrical service and installation (Panel installation, controller mounting and wiring, communication wire pulling
- Support or lead efforts in validation, commissioning and project implementation of Building Automation System with Schneider Electric Products or others (@ Site)
- Test/Validate the hardware/software for correct operation as they apply to HVAC control, lighting, water, etc.
- Testing and ensure quality installation of graphical interface for client
- Analyze Building Automation Systems and recommend changes to improve functionality and/or energy efficiency or to accomplish Energy Conservation Measures
- Mark-Up building automation and integrated system drawings, specifications, and reports by use of digital means (typically Microsoft Suite of products - Visio, Excel, Word, etc.) for record keeping
- Material handling of Building Automation System products for implementation
- Ensure conformance to industry design standards and local codes
- Provide input to other engineers during initial and subsequent installation phases.
- Participate in strategic initiatives as assigned to drive continuous improvement
- Deliver solutions with first-time quality while maintaining high levels of internal and external client satisfaction
- Continually enforce safety to the highest standards and maintains security and accountability of company issued and procured assets by recording use, wear, and conditions.
- Lead efforts as the technical resource for Building Automation System with Construction team
- Displays team effort and dedication to client by maintaining flexibility to work as the business requires
- Provide status and progress reports to project team and management
- Ensure conformance to industry design standards
- Assist in technical training and support for both internally and externally
- Identify and develop necessary technical documentation to assist in streamlining the design of Building Automation Systems for clients
- Stay abreast of new development/releases of technology and apply to projects and processes as necessary
- Assist clients and team members with any Building Automation System operations, software, networking problems
- Develop and maintain positive relationships with internal and external clients
- Prepare letters, memos, and other routine correspondence and documentation in accordance with established company procedures
- Ability to be both an individual contributor as well as a mentor of entry level employees

- 5+ years of equivalent work experience preferred
- Experience with low voltage electrical installation for Building Automation Systems or equivalent
- Ability to manage multiple projects with varying demands and requirements ranging from small projects to large projects, self-performed or 3rd party execution, and complexity. Ability to understand when additional expertise is required and seek out support.
- Understand and lead the knowledge share of Automation Systems and Heating, Ventilation and Air-Conditioning Systems (HVAC).
- This role requires a strong technical competency, experience in construction and automation management best practices, ability to demonstrate experience and independent responsibility with high confidence in the automation field.
- Natural problem solver and active learner required
- Strong communication (written and verbal) and project management/organization skills required
- Knowledge of industry codes and standards: ASHRAE, NEC, NFPA, UL
- Familiarity with building automation protocols and standards, such as BACnet, Modbus, LonWorks
- Understanding of HVAC, electrical systems and control systems required
- Schneider Electric Building Automation System platforms (Vista, Continuum, I/Net, StruxureWare, EcoStruxure, and/or Invensys) highly preferred.
- Working experience with other building automation vendors (Johnson Controls, Honeywell, Allerton, Automated Logic, etc.) highly preferred.
- Ability to understand HVAC drawings, electrical drawings, scope of work documents and schematics required
- IT knowledge and interworking of control systems is highly preferred (Ex. IP functionality, Wi-Fi, Routers, Switches, and equipment topology)
- Valid driver's license required with no major or frequent traffic violations
- Proficient in Procore and Microsoft Office programs including but not limited to, Word, Excel, TEAMs, and MS Project required
- Strong basic math skills required
- Ability to thoroughly understand and follow plans and specifications in the construction of a project required
- Passionate about customer service and team success required
- Expert ability to adjust to changes, adapt and overcome challenges as required
- High travel percentage required. Travel could be via car or plane.
This position is highly physical and requires regular use of hands, fingers, walking, stooping, kneeling, and climbing ladders. It requires employees to regularly lift and or move up to 10 lbs. and frequently lift and/or move up to 40 lbs. (may occasionally lift and/or move more than 40 lbs. with special approval.) Moving over rough or uneven surfaces; recurring bending, crouching, stooping, stretching, reaching, or similar activities; recurring lifting of moderately heavy to light items. Transporting of items such as a ladder, tools, laptop computer and luggage; driving an automobile, etc. WORK ENVIRONMENT : The work environment characteristics described here are representative of those an employee encounters while performing the primary duties of this job.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the primary duties. While performing the primary functions of the job, the employee is regularly exposed to a general office environment and construction site environment. During periods of project site visits, the employee will be exposed to outside weather conditions, roof tops, attics, as well as mechanical and electrical equipment rooms which could consist of confined spaces and loud noises. Employee may work in different environments while on various job sites.
Ability to travel full time to project sites required. Automation work occurs in various locations across the Southeastern United States, and on occasion nationally. Normal work schedule is Mon-Fri with travel to the project on Mondays and travel home on Friday mornings but can change depending on project requirements. Special project circumstances may occasionally require additional working hours on weekends; however, this is typically scheduled in advance.
